I keep getting this error while trying to install SimplePortal 2.3.2:

"You cannot download or install new packages because the Packages directory or one of the files in it are not writable!"

Thing is, I KNOW all the contents of that directory are writable.  So I clear my browser cache, start the install again, all tests pass successfully, FTP connection is successful, and then it gives me that error.  I even set the entire SMF directory to be writable but this didn't seem to help.

Any insight on what I'm doing wrong?

Kays

Hi, try adding a folder named temp to the Packages folder.

As Kays says, please add the temp file and make sure package directory is writable (I'm pretty sure you did this already).

Draetheus

Yep, just FTPed in and added a temp folder with no problem inside the Packages directory.

Nope, didn't work for either mod I tried to install (SimplePortal and SMF Arcade).  Going to dump my SMF install to XAMPP on my local PC to see if its a problem with my web host.

Draetheus

Well damn...worked fine on my local XAMPP setup.  Guess my webhost must suck.   :(


rd


Draetheus

Fixed!  I had to delete and recreate the subdomain that SMF was running off of on my domain.  I'm not sure why this worked...oh well.

Anywho I used 000webhost because this is just a hobby/friends only site and I didn't see the need to pay for hosting.  I may change my mind if things like these keep happening, however.   :P

flapjack

this was something I wanted to suggest, smf tends to have problems with free hosting providers and with windows hosting accounts
